The Ransomed Return to Zion
35 The wilderness and the dry land will be glad;
the desert will rejoice and blossom like a wildflower.[a](A)
2 It will blossom abundantly
and will also rejoice with joy and singing.
The glory of Lebanon will be given to it,
the splendor of Carmel and Sharon.(B)
They will see the glory of the Lord,(C)
the splendor of our God.(D)
Footnotes
- 35:1 Or meadow saffron; traditionally rose
Isaiah 35:10
Christian Standard Bible
10 and the ransomed of the Lord will return(A)
and come to Zion with singing,
crowned with unending joy.
Joy and gladness will overtake them,
and sorrow and sighing will flee.(B)
